sin'u1intg pers pronWho is the person involved in an event or in a particular state?Sin'u occurs as a predicate, followed by the topic determiner 'ang (or variant -ng) and a substantive phrase.Sin'ung mangasāwa sa 'ākun? Sayud ninda nga 'aku, hay may 'asāwa na.Who would court me? They know that, as for me, [I] already have a husband.intg pers pron'ābir sin'u1varbīsan sin'u2maskin sin'u3indef pers pronanyone, everyone'Ābir sin'u or variant indicates anyone or everyone involved in a present or future event or state. For an event or state in past time, see bīsan kanin'u, under kanin'u 2.Puydi makasuksuk ning singsing 'ābir sin'u basta 'igwa sya ning 'ikabakay.It is possible for anyone to wear a ring if she has [money] which will be able to be used in buying it.Maskin sin'u hay pwīdi magtanum basta gustu nya magtanum.It is possible for anyone to plant if he wants to plant.'Ang 'unga' nga ma'āyu, hay ginatāhud nang bīsan sin'u.As for a good child, [he] is treated well by everyone.cfbīsan kanin'u2ka1 bīsan sin'u3varkung sin'u1maskin sin'u2indef pers pronno matter who'Ang kwartu nang 'inda magūyang wayay makasuyud, bīsan sin'u nga 'inda 'unga'.As for the bedroom of their parents, no one was able to go inside, no matter who of their children.Bīsan sin'u nga tāwu hay 'indi' mahīmu' nga parihu nang pagpalangga' ku sa 'ākun 'asāwa.No matter who the person [is], he cannot match my love towards my wife.Sinda hay nakatu'ip nga magbinuligan, kung sin'u 'ang nagakahinangyan ning būlig.As for them, they learned to help each other, no matter who needed help.Maskin sin'u 'ang magpakadtu sa 'iya, hay 'indi' siya magkadtu.No matter who the one is to send him, he would not go.kung sin'u2rel pers pronwho the person involved in an event or in a particular state is'Ang 'ākun lang 'adtu ginapangamuyu' nga kabay pa nga masayūran gid kung sin'u 'ang nagpangawat ning kwarta.The only thing that I am praying for is, may it be that it will be known who the one is who extensively stole the money.Nagpinamāti' 'ānay 'aku kung sin'u 'ang nagakayas ning gitāra.At first I kept on listening [to find out] who the one strumming the guitar is.For another meaning of kung sin'u, see sense 2 below.
